Tallyman i’m not suggesting this applies to you, but one thing for drivers who aren’t familiar with digi tachos to watch for…

on doing a print out you may well see over speed warnings… but look carefully at the date on them, they may not be from the day you drove it.

A company attempted to give me a lecture on collecting so many in one day, until i pointed this out to them! :blush: :blush:

And that from the guy who had been on the digi tach course!
